New serious vulnerabilities spiked around release of Claude Mythos Preview
22 days ago
- In April 2026, Anthropic announced its Claude Mythos Preview model capable of autonomous cybersecurity vulnerability discovery and exploitation.
- Anthropic and OpenAI then began using frontier models to harden critical software before malicious actors could use the same models for harm.
- The number of Common Vulnerabilities and Exposures (CVEs) increased significantly after these announcements.
- High- and critical-severity vulnerabilities increased more than 3.5 times in June compared to the previous monthly record before the Mythos Preview announcement.
